[Saba Sports News] During the badminton competition at the Paris Olympics, Chinese athlete He Bingjiao undoubtedly became the biggest beneficiary and the biggest loser. In the women’s singles semi-finals, He Bingjiao’s opponent was Rio Olympics women’s singles champion Carolina Marin Martin. In the match, Marin suffered an injury while leading 1-0 and sadly retired, allowing He Bingjiao to advance to the finals. In the women’s singles final, He Bingjiao had almost no resistance against South Korean newcomer An Se-young. In the end, An Se-young easily defeated He Bingjiao 2-0 and won the Olympic badminton women’s singles gold medal. After the match, He Bingjiao faced criticism from many fans for not showing enough resistance and fighting spirit, and even faced online harassment. After failing to win the gold medal in women’s singles, He Bingjiao was forced to apologize to the fans on social media. Presumably due to the online harassment, on August 13, 27-year-old He Bingjiao suddenly announced her retirement. It is reported that He Bingjiao has submitted a retirement application to the Badminton World Federation and will no longer participate in international-level competitions. According to the latest world rankings released by the BWF, He Bingjiao, who was previously ranked seventh in women’s singles badminton, has now disappeared from the list, which means she will officially bid farewell to her beloved badminton court.
